The effects of climate change are causing significant social and economic issues throughout the Asia and Pacific region. Digital technologies are proving crucial in building climate and disaster resilience and enhancing environmental sustainability. 

The Asia-Australia Online Short Course: Digital Technologies for a Climate Resilient Water Sector aims to build the capacity of the Asian Development Bank (ADB) project teams and developing member country (DMC) counterpart staff in the knowledge and use of digital technologies to improve water management and inclusive participation in decision-making, contributing to water security and climate change resilience. 

This online course is suitable for practitioners, policy makers, decision makers, utility directors and employees of water associations involved in ADB-funded water management projects.

The course is funded by the Australian government through the Australian Water Partnership and supported by ADB.
